i have used the one click install for madwifi. i have an atheros 5005g adapter. i have gone to yast>network> devices and tried to add a wireless device but i still can't get the network manager in the system tray. i am using suse 10.3.

the madwifi installation was successful. what is the procedure from this point until i can see available wireless networks in my system tray?

In Yast you need to specify to use a network manager instead of than "traditional method with ifup". E.g see pic #11 in this internet link (but put the dot beside to use network manager). And of course you need the network manager software installed e.g. KnetworkManager (KDE) or nm-applet (Gnome) or wifi-radar (KDE and Gnome). And finally arrange for the manager to start at boot. E.g in KDE the manager is at search in menu = knetw
